还剩10页未读,继续阅读
本资源只提供10页预览,全部文档请下载后查看!喜欢就下载吧,查找使用更方便
文本内容:
高中数学算法的意义
1.1课件苏教版必修欢迎来到高中数学算法的意义课件!在这个课件中,我们将学习算法的基
1.1本概念、排序算法、查找算法、图论算法、动态规划算法、数值计算算法、线性规划算法、组合算法、概率算法以及人工智能算法让我们一起探索数学中的精髓!算法基本概念定义1算法是解决问题的一系列有序步骤特性2算法应当具有正确性、可读性、健壮性和高效性应用3算法在计算机科学、数学和物理等领域有广泛应用排序算法冒泡排序插入排序通过相邻元素的比较和交换来排序将未排序元素插入已排序部分的合适位置快速排序归并排序通过选择一个基准元素将数组分成两部分并递将数组分成两部分并递归地排序,然后合并两归排序部分的结果查找算法顺序查找1逐个地比较查找目标和数组元素,直到找到或搜索完所有元素二分查找2通过每次将搜索区域分成两部分来快速定位目标哈希查找3利用哈希函数将目标映射到一个索引,然后在该索引处进行查找图论算法最短路径算法最小生成树算法寻找两个顶点之间最短路径的算法,如算寻找连接所有顶点且总权值最小的树的算法,如Dijkstra法算法Prim动态规划算法背包问题最长公共子序列问题最长递增子序列问题在给定容量限制下,选择物品寻找两个序列中最长公共子序寻找给定序列中最长递增子序使得总价值最大化的问题列的问题列的问题数值计算算法牛顿迭代法龙贝格积分法梯形积分法使用切线逼近函数零点的方法通过逐步提高精度,计算函数将函数曲线下的面积近似为梯的积分形的面积线性规划算法单纯形法1通过迭代计算顶点找到最优解的方法对偶单纯形法2对转置形式的线性规划问题应用单纯形法组合算法排列组合置换群格雷码计算从集合中选择元素的不同排研究元素的排列所形成的群结构一组连续的二进制码,任意两个列和组合的方法码字只有一个位数变动概率算法蒙特卡罗方法拉斯维加斯算法贝叶斯算法123利用随机抽样验证数学结运行时间在随机输入上始利用贝叶斯定理进行概率论的方法终都是有界的算法推断的方法人工智能算法遗传算法通过模拟生物进化过程来解决支持向量机算法优化问题的算法神经网络算法通过寻找最优超平面来分类数据集的算法模拟生物神经元网络进行学习和预测的算法总结在本课件中,我们学习了算法的基本概念、各种不同类型的算法以及它们在各领域中的应用希望同学们通过学习这些内容,能够更好地理解数学中算法的意义,并能够应用它们解决实际问题。
个人认证
优秀文档
获得点赞 0